In my short research I found an article on the web that talked about a young man that had received a picture from his girl friend. This is what the article said,

“The Sentinel tells the story of Phillip Alpert. After his former girlfriend taunted him, Alpert remembered the nude photos she e-mailed to him while they were dating. He took revenge by e-mailing the photos of the 16-year-old girl to more than 70 people, including her parents, grandparents and teachers. Three days later, Alpert, then 18, was charged with transmitting child pornography. Today, Alpert is serving five years of probation for the crime, and he is registered as a sex offender — a label he must carry at least until he is 43.”

This is a very dangerous practice that can mark you for life. I think my message will be, “DO NOT FORWARD SEXTING MESSAGES AND BLOCK THOSE THAT SEND THEM TO YOU!”
